  • Abstract
    Many factors influence the choice of equalization for high speed serial link. This paper presents the analysis and optimization of combined equalizer for high speed serial link based on the ADS simulation. By modeling the high speed serial link, which mainly includes the equalization for the loss of channel, the performance of various equalizers including pre-emphasis in transmitter, CTLE/DFE in receiver and some combined equalizers are analyzed for different channels. The results show that much better performance can be obtained by using some combined equalization architectures compared to using CTLE or DFE separately, and the cost is only a little increase in complexity.
